The hunt is on for a team of Irish students to compete in Dare to Be Digital
The Irish leg of the international Dare to Be Digital games development competition has been launched today by the Digital Hub Development Agency (DHDA) and applications are now open for third-level students from a variety of academic backgrounds.
Dare to Be Digital will be co-ordinated in Ireland by the DHDA, supported by the North-South Cooperation Unit at the Department of Education and Skills, and provides participants with the opportunity to connect with leading computer games companies. Dr Stephen Brennan, chief strategy officer with the DHDA, believes this could give students a realistic route into this sector.
